Abstract
A system to operationally monitor snow cover in the Swiss Alps using NOAA-AVHRR data is presented. The data are calibrated and normalised to allow the application of physically based classification thresholds. The results of the analysis of two time series of images dating from the years 1992 and 1996 are displayed. First experiences gathered during the real-time application in 1999 are reported
